Overview of cryptocurrency scams

Cryptocurrency scams have become increasingly prevalent due to the surge in popularity and value of cryptocurrencies. Scammers often use deceptive tactics to lure unsuspecting individuals into fraudulent schemes, promising high returns and quick profits. It is crucial to exercise caution when engaging in cryptocurrency trading and to thoroughly research any trading platform before investing.

Common red flags of scams

  • Unrealistic promises: Scammers often make exaggerated claims of high returns and guaranteed profits, which are not realistic in the volatile cryptocurrency market.
  • Lack of transparency: Legitimate trading platforms provide clear information about their company background, team members, and regulatory compliance. Scammers, on the other hand, tend to hide this information or provide false credentials.
  • Pressure tactics: Scammers often use high-pressure tactics to rush individuals into making hasty investment decisions, without allowing them to conduct proper due diligence.
  • Unsecured website: Legitimate trading platforms prioritize the security of their users' personal and financial information. Scammers may have poorly secured websites, making users vulnerable to data breaches and identity theft.

Understanding Cryptocurrency Trading

Basics of cryptocurrency trading

Cryptocurrency trading involves buying and selling digital assets (cryptocurrencies) on various trading platforms. Traders aim to profit from the price fluctuations of cryptocurrencies by buying low and selling high. Cryptocurrency trading can be done on centralized exchanges, decentralized exchanges, or through trading platforms like Crypto Trader.

Different types of trading strategies

There are various trading strategies that traders can use to profit from cryptocurrency trading, including:

  • Day trading: Traders buy and sell cryptocurrencies within a single day, taking advantage of short-term price fluctuations.
  • Swing trading: Traders hold onto cryptocurrencies for a few days or weeks to profit from medium-term price movements.
  • Scalping: Traders make quick trades to profit from small price movements, usually within minutes or hours.
  • Trend trading: Traders identify long-term trends in the market and aim to profit from the overall price direction of cryptocurrencies.

Technical analysis tools for trading cryptocurrencies

Technical analysis involves analyzing historical price data and using various indicators to predict future price movements. Some common technical analysis tools used in cryptocurrency trading include:

  • Moving averages: These indicators smooth out price data to identify trends and potential support/resistance levels.
  • Relative Strength Index (RSI): The RSI measures the strength and speed of price movements to identify overbought or oversold conditions.
  • Bollinger Bands: Bollinger Bands show the volatility of a cryptocurrency and help identify potential price breakouts or reversals.
  • Fibonacci retracement: This tool identifies potential support and resistance levels based on the Fibonacci sequence.

Risk management and setting stop-loss orders

Risk management is an essential aspect of cryptocurrency trading. Traders should set clear risk management strategies to protect their capital and minimize losses. One common risk management technique is setting stop-loss orders, which automatically sell a cryptocurrency when it reaches a predetermined price. This helps limit potential losses and protects against market volatility.
